The blue-haired lawyer is Springfield's most prominent lawyer known for his pasty face, blue hair, and nasal New York accent.
Contents
Work
He is one of Mr. Burns' lawyers. Many times, he has shown up when the Simpsons are in court (usually on the opponent's side) and quite often makes good points and wins over the judge.
His most prominent client is Mr. Burns, but he has worked for Fat Tony,[1] Disneyland,[2] the Sea Captain and the Frying Dutchman,[3] Sideshow Bob,[4] Roger Meyers, Jr. and the Itchy & Scratchy Studios,[5][6] Movementarians,[7] the estate of Charlie Chaplin,[8] Bart Simpson[9] and the estate of Jimmy Durante.[8]
Love Life
Blue-haired lawyer's love life is virtually non-existent, though he was once seen on a date with fellow Republican Lindsey Naegle [10] as well as a date with Cookie Kwan (deleted scene).[11]
Politics
He is a member of the Springfield Republican Party.[12]

Behind the Laughter
The blue-haired lawyer was inspired by American attorney Roy Cohn.[13]
